Think of all that you discuss as the EFFECT. Then think of kuwait data the set-up and backswing as the CAUSE. Everything you do in the backswing, will have a downswing consequence.
OR think of the backswing as a collection of
INDEPENDENT VARIABLES and the downswing as a (poor, helpless) bunch of DEPENDENT VARIABLES.
Truly, the only effect we need to know about is that the ball must be struck with maximum possible speed, on its inside right quadrant and below its equator. [ONLY if we want ideal impact – straight, far and high – of course!]
We also need to know that
The only downswing body movement pattern that can help us do all of the above is what is known as a ‘sequential summation of forces’ (SSF) aka ‘kinematic sequence’.
That’s IT, folks. STOP wasting time (and perhaps university database d funding money) on effects, let’s discuss HOW we can get EVERY GOLFER from Tyro to Tiger to make that highly-sophisticate ‘from the ground up’ rotation of the body – SSF.
Bottom-line we nee to understand where each of the major body joints needs to be at impact, then work backwards from there by placing every one of those joints in positions they can be most efficient from (in planes they are DESIGNE to work best in)!
